520 ## - SUMMARY, ETC.
Summary, etc. Proposes a generic model to assign overhead costs not only to projects but also to activities and project elements, making it useful in various decision-making situations in building construction projects. Argues that the traditional method of allocating overhead costs to projects is inadequate in providing sufficiently accurate cost distribution. Tables and references.
